Broken window repair services involve the assessment and replacement of damaged or shattered glass in residential, commercial, and retail properties. These services typically include removing broken glass safely, preparing the window frame for new glass, and installing a replacement pane to restore the window’s integrity. Professionals may also address issues related to window seals, framing damage, or hardware that may be affected during the repair process. The goal is to restore the window’s appearance and functionality while preventing further damage or security issues.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with broken or cracked windows, such as compromised security, increased energy loss, and reduced property aesthetic appeal. Cracked or shattered glass can pose safety hazards from sharp edges and falling shards, while broken windows can also lead to drafts and higher utility costs. Repairing or replacing windows promptly can help maintain a comfortable indoor environment and protect property from the elements and potential intruders.

Broken Window Repair Costs - The cost for repairing a broken window typically ranges from $150 to $400 per window, depending on size and damage extent. Larger or custom windows may cost more, sometimes exceeding $500.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Materials and Labor - Expenses for materials and labor usually fall between $100 and $300 per window. Factors influencing costs include window type, frame material, and accessibility of the repair site.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may arise for emergency repairs or if the window is in a hard-to-reach location, potentially adding $50 to $150. Some repairs may require additional services like frame replacement, influencing overall pricing.
Cost Variability - Prices for broken window repairs can vary significantly based on location, window size, and damage severity. In Livingston, NJ and nearby areas, typical costs reflect these factors, making estimates from local pros essential for accurate budgeting.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
